I built my interactive resume because a traditional resumecould not fully represent my career. I don’t have a formal degree, and my experience covers customer support, HR operations, Technology PMO, leadership hiring, entrepreneurship and product building. On paper, these can look like unrelated roles. In reality, every role taught me how to understand customers, manage people, improve processes and take ownership of results. I wanted employers to see more than job titles. The Operator Console lets recruiters choose a real business challenge and understand how my experience could help solve it. It is my way of demonstrating how I think and work—not simply describing what I have done.
